[elbe-devel] [PATCH 00/10] debian: fix most warnings

Eduard Krein eduard.krein at linutronix.de
Tue Jun 4 16:55:01 CEST 2024


Am 03.05.2024 um 10:31 schrieb Thomas Weißschuh:

> Fixes for some warnings reported during packaging.
> Also bump debhelper compat to 13.
>
> Signed-off-by: Thomas Weißschuh <thomas.weissschuh at linutronix.de>

Reviewed-by: Eduard Krein<eduard.krein at linutronix.de>

For the whole series

> ---
> Thomas Weißschuh (10):
>        debian: fix syntax error around sphinxdoc:Depends
>        debian: remove obsolete lsb-base dependency
>        debian: fix copyright globs
>        debian: add ${python3:Depends} stanzas
>        debian: make use of sphinxdoc:Built-Using
>        debian: simplify install paths
>        debian: don't write bytecode during build
>        debian: package elbe check-build command
>        debian: mark schema files as uninstalled
>        debian: switch to compat 13
>
>   debian/control                           | 30 +++++------
>   debian/copyright                         | 10 +---
>   debian/elbe-doc.install                  |  4 +-
>   debian/not-installed                     |  3 ++
>   debian/python3-elbe-bin.install          | 45 ++++++++--------
>   debian/python3-elbe-bootup-check.install |  2 +-
>   debian/python3-elbe-buildenv.install     | 50 ++++++++---------
>   debian/python3-elbe-common.install       | 93 ++++++++++++++++----------------
>   debian/python3-elbe-control.install      | 10 ++--
>   debian/python3-elbe-daemon.install       | 12 ++---
>   debian/python3-elbe-soap.install         | 10 ++--
>   debian/python3-elbe-updated.install      |  6 +--
>   debian/rules                             |  2 +
>   13 files changed, 138 insertions(+), 139 deletions(-)
> ---
> base-commit: 334ef3f70c18166a810bf3b28e482dbb2458efe0
> change-id: 20240502-packaging-ed37e1fd1b41
>
> Best regards,

-- 
Eduard Krein
Linutronix GmbH | Bahnhofstrasse 3 | D-88690 Uhldingen-Mühlhofen
Phone: +49 7556 25 999 19; Fax.: +49 7556 25 999 99

Hinweise zum Datenschutz finden Sie hier (Informations on data privacy
can be found here): https://linutronix.de/legal/data-protection.php

Linutronix GmbH | Firmensitz (Registered Office): Uhldingen-Mühlhofen |
Registergericht (Registration Court): Amtsgericht Freiburg i.Br.,
HRB700 806 | Geschäftsführer (Managing Directors): Heinz Egger, Thomas
Gleixner, Tiffany Silva, Sean Fennelly, Jeffrey Schneiderman



More information about the elbe-devel mailing list